#a7b6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7b6ec is composed of 65.5% red, 71.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 79%. #a7b6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4f6dd9.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#a7b6ec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a7b6ec has RGB values of R:167, G:182,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 10991340.

Shades and Tints of #a7b6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020309 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7b6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c9cb is the less saturated color, while #97adfc is the most saturated one.
